I am working on getting more VG sounds.
The Kemper profiles VG-99 amp sounds very well.
Its amazing how well the "footprint" of any modeler or distortion pedal can be captured. with the Kemper.
I have never heard anything that can do this.
Its the top end that the Kemper duplicates that blows me away.
I have spent many HOURS eq-ing and spectral matching units only to have the Kemper do it in a simple profile. If you listen to the top end of what you profile its just mind bending how close it.
That upper stuff is the hardest to get right. -

Thanks guys!
I am working on the nylon now, but Its hard as the nylon sound is VERY much about the attack/release of the sound.
Its a plastic string and making a metal string sound the same requires more than just eq changes,
BUT....with the new gates who knows it might work.The EHX Superego is a time based effect so its no able to be profiled.
The Superego is an amazing effect that opens the world of granular synthesis to guitar players.
Here is the demo I did for EHX.http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=ZO3A_nhNf54
It plays great in the effect loop of the Kemper. -
